Overview

The Honeywell PRO42R2B is a wired dual reader board designed for integration into Honeywell access control infrastructure, specifically the PRO4200 series. This module enables simultaneous credential processing across two readers, which directly improves throughput in multi-door and multi-lane security deployments. Instead of queuing credential reads or installing separate control modules per reader, the PRO42R2B consolidates dual-reader logic onto a single board, reducing hardware footprint and wiring complexity. The board implements Open Supervised Device Protocol (OSDP) compliance, meaning you're not locked into proprietary communication — it works with any OSDP-compatible access control ecosystem, protecting your investment if you upgrade or integrate third-party readers later.

Key Features

  • Dual Reader Support: Handles two readers simultaneously, eliminating the throughput bottleneck that occurs when a single reader board must process credentials one at a time. Real benefit: faster card reads in high-traffic zones (lobbies, secure gates, warehouse receiving) where delays compound.
  • OSDP Protocol Compliance: Open Supervised Device Protocol is the industry standard for reader-to-controller communication. This means you can swap reader brands (HID, Salto, Axis, Honeywell) without reconfiguring the PRO42R2B — the protocol layer abstracts the hardware difference. Reduces vendor lock-in and simplifies mixed-brand installations.
  • Wired Connectivity: Hardwired connections (no wireless or network dependency) guarantee reliable operation in electrically noisy environments and eliminate latency concerns. Critical in data centers, secure facilities, and industrial settings where a dropped signal could trigger a lockdown or false alarm.
  • Honeywell PRO4200 Integration: Purpose-built for PRO4200 series controllers. You won't need adapters, firmware patches, or workarounds — the board plugs directly into the controller's expansion slots, reducing commissioning time and support calls.
  • Compact Form Factor: The dual-reader logic is consolidated on a single board rather than distributed across multiple modules, lowering cabinet space requirements in control rooms and reducing cable routing overhead in complex multi-door layouts.

Deployment Considerations

This board is purpose-built for the PRO4200 family; confirm your controller model before ordering. OSDP support is a strength for multi-vendor environments, but if your readers are legacy proprietary models, verify driver support with your integrator. Wired installation requires proper cable routing and termination — factor in labor if you're adding readers to an existing infrastructure. The dual-reader architecture assumes you need two readers on a single board; if you need four or more independent reader channels, you may need multiple PRO42R2B boards or a different controller platform.

When to Choose a Different Model

If you're running a different Honeywell access control platform (e.g., ProWatch, ConfigAware, or legacy panel systems), this board will not integrate directly. Consult your system documentation or integrator. If you need wireless readers or networked access control via TCP/IP rather than hardwired connections, explore Honeywell's IP-based reader boards or cloud-enabled solutions.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Does the PRO42R2B support both card and PIN readers simultaneously?

A: The PRO42R2B supports dual readers on a single board; the reader type (card, PIN, biometric, multitech) depends on the specific reader devices you connect. OSDP protocol passes credential data from the reader to the controller; the PRO4200 firmware handles authentication logic.

Q: Can I mix different reader brands on the two channels?

A: Yes. OSDP compliance means you can pair readers from different manufacturers on the same board, provided both readers support the OSDP protocol and your PRO4200 controller is configured to handle multi-vendor credentials.

Q: Is the PRO42R2B NDAA Section 889 compliant?

A: Refer to Honeywell's NDAA compliance documentation or contact your integrator for certification status on this specific board.

Q: What's the maximum cable run distance from the readers to the PRO42R2B?

A: Consult the PRO42R2B datasheet for OSDP cable length limits and electrical specifications. Typical wired reader runs support distances up to 300–500 feet depending on cable gauge and noise environment.

Q: Can the PRO42R2B be field-installed, or does it require factory configuration?

A: It integrates into PRO4200 expansion slots and is typically provisioned during system setup. Your integrator will assign reader addresses and configure credential processing logic in the PRO4200 firmware.
